| Text: | The precepts of the Word are pure |
| Author: | Rev. Emanuel Cronenwett, D. D. |
| Tune: | MENDON |
| Arranger: | Lowell Mason, Mus. Doc. |
1 The precepts of the Word are pure,
Its promises and hopes endure;
That statutes of the Lord are right,
In keeping them is great delight.
2 The teachings of God's Word impart
His gracious counsels to the heart,
And higher principles instil,
And mould anew the heart and will.
3 Lord, Thy commands be our delight,
Thy Gospel be our saving might;
And by thy truth on us impress
The image of Thy holiness.
4 Then will our life, in turn, conform
Unto Thy Word, as guide and norm:
And by our walk it shall appear,
That our profession is sincere.
5 Grace grace for grace to us anew,
To practice still what we hold true;
And grant that what we hold, dear Lord,
Be the pure doctrines of Thy Word.
